10 Michel DUPIEUX IRAP Progress Meeting LAL 02/03/2012 10 Gondola CNES equipments -SIREN (TM/TC) 290 x 285 x 84 mm, 3.175 kg 12-18V, 13 W 24 H autonomy with 3.9 kg batteries -ICDV (Attitude measurement, shock, T°…) 210 x 175 x 88 mm, 1 kg 12-28V, 10 W Inertial measurement unit : 3 gyrometers +/- 300°/s 3 accelerometers +/- 18g magnetometer 3 axis, Attitude restitution : ~1°, 100Hz Accelerometer 3 axis +/- 50g, 0-800Hz 1 PT100 thermal sensor -60 +100°C 23 H autonomy with 1.2 kg batteries
